"Turkey's PKK-DTP Operations Further Complicate Kurdish Solution
Publication: Eurasia Daily Monitor Volume: 6 Issue: 77
April 22, 2009 06:32 PM Age: 4 hrs
Category: Eurasia Daily Monitor, Home Page, Military/Security, Turkey
By: Lale Sariibrahimoglu

Simultaneous operations recently conducted in twelve Turkish cities against what police sources described as urban networks of the outlawed Kurdistan Workers Party (PKK) in which 120 people were detained, including senior members of the pro-Kurdish Kurdistan Society Party (DTP) represented in the Parliament, was widely seen as jeopardizing attempts to find a peaceful solution to the Kurdish question. 'They [the Kurds] have given a message following the local elections that nobody should fear from the Kurds. But they [the political authorities] could not stand this. They have launched an operation against our party [DTP] following the elections,' Ahmet Turk, DTP Chairman and Deputy stated in London (Sabah, April 21)."
